Hernia pain study pulled before it started

NCT ID NCT06709612

First seen Jan 05, 2026 · Last updated May 13, 2026 · Updated 24 times

Summary

This study was designed to test a new pain medicine called AMT-143 for people recovering from hernia surgery. It planned to enroll adults having open inguinal hernia repair and measure safety, pain levels, and how the drug works in the body. However, the study was withdrawn before any participants were enrolled.
